Little Vic and the Great Mafia War with Larry McShane
In this gripping episode of Gangland Wire, retired Intelligence Detective Gary Jenkins welcomes back veteran crime journalist and mob historian Larry McShane to discuss his latest book, Little Vic and the Great Mafia War. Together, they dive deep into the violent and chaotic period known as the Third Colombo War—a brutal internal conflict that nearly tore the Colombo crime family apart. Larry offers exclusive insights from his research, including rare interviews with Andrew Arena, one of the five sons of Victor "Little Vic" Orena, the acting boss at the center of the war. Episode 7.8: George Paterson (Pt. 2)
The COTI podcasts are sponsored by the Concrete Gang in cooperation with 3CR Community Radio. For a full list of episodes and access to all pictures and links, visit www.3cr.org.au/coti In Part Two of his conversation with Ralph Edwards, bricklayer and organiser George Paterson starts in the late '80s, with his work as an organiser in the eastern suburbs of Melbourne and the early days of Building Industry Group (BIG) campaigning. Episode 3.3: Peter Ballard
Series 3, Episode 3: Series 3 of COTI focuses on the construction industry in WA. Building workers are building workers and building work is building work wherever you are. On this episode of Creatures of the Industry, Ralph talks to Peter Ballard about his experiences in the industry. From his introduction to workplace politics in shearing sheds, starting out as a brickies labourer, his later involvement in notorious disputes in both VIC and WA, and through to retirement, this episode includes discussions about workers, awards, conditions, and more.
